Output 66675e281b3efeb64c4c21f11398e5234b274b390c6eb84ab1e00beae80306f1:3

value
3606728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d415c29ae4b9da8f719faccf43f3469fb1562de OP_EQUALVERIFY OP_CHECKSIG
address
158HhvgYPaaVEXXP5DxKY9jWGmHTiM8ZFD
transaction
66675e281b3efeb64c4c21f11398e5234b274b390c6eb84ab1e00beae80306f1
spent
true